
Welcome to the Revenue Builders podcast, a weekly show featuring B2B sales leaders and executives. Hosted by Five-time CRO John McMahon and Force Management’s Co-Founder John Kaplan, the show goes in the barrel, behind the scenes with the people who have been there, done that and seen the results. Focused on B2B sales, this series highlights deep conversations with industry leaders, offering meaningful insights into effective business growth strategies and leadership practices. The discussions cover a range of topics, such as team culture, sales performance, leadership qualities, and the importance of accountability, providing actionable takeaways for aspiring sales professionals and executives alike. Guests are experienced individuals from various successful organizations, sharing their experiences and strategies for overcoming challenges in sales and scaling businesses.
